熟悉Java语言、能独自开发、搭建项目、模块设计、解决问题,有良好的编码能力和习惯,常写注释,代码清晰简洁;
熟练使用主流框架、熟悉数据库的设计与使用
框架:Spring、SpringMVC、Hibernate、MyBatis、MyBatis-Plus、Dubbo、SpringBoot、SpringCloud(目前在用springboot+springcloud+nacos+mybatis-plus)
中间件:Redis、MongoDB、Solr、RabbitMQ、RocketMQ(目前在用 redis、rocketmq)
数据库:SqlServer、MySQL(目前在用mysql)
容器:熟悉Linux常用操作、Docker、Jenkins(目前在用启动脚本和自动化部署)
网约车项目(springboot+dubbo+mybatis+redis+mongodb+rockermq)
负责研发自营网约车系统,包含安卓端和苹果端(乘客端、司机端),小程序端(乘客端),web管理后台,类型分为快车、专车、出租车、代驾、顺风车、城际专线,为用户提供安全、便捷、高品质的出行服务,系统分为各个服务模块,如订单、产品等服务,涵盖推送功能、延时功能、支付功能、统计功能、扫码下单功能、推广分销功能、通知公告功能、月卡功能、活动及优惠券功能、报警功能、分享功能、流转分成功能等等,系统采用极光推送实现乘客端与司机端的消息响应,司机的定位利用分表保存。